Database Builder

This document explains how to use and configure the DataFlex Database Builder tool.

Database Builder enables you to create, modify, and delete the tables used in a DataFlex application. In addition, it enables you to repair indexes and data, and to restructure tables (including tables from earlier revisions of DataFlex).
